Usually while eating I watch primarily just the following: Univisión, the primary US channel in Spanish, the local and world news, and "Lawrence Welk", the "champagne music" bandleader who died in 1992. His shows were popular in the US between 1955 and 1982 and now educational TV channels play his historic shows. The last fifteen minutes of the one-hour presentations feature an interview of one of his musicians. Of course many of his musicians have already passed on. I don't know how much of "Lawrence Welk" has penetrated countries other than the United States. Of course what I watch is just a tiny fraction of what's available on cable TV in the US.

Finnish (free) tv channels:
YLE TV1, YLE TV2, MTV3, Nelonen, Subtv
FST5, JIM, Urheilukanava, The Voice, YLE Extra, YLE Teema
Finnish (not free) tv channels:
MTV3 MAX, Subtv Leffa, MTV3 Fakta, Subtv Juniori

There are about 30 digital tv channels on air here in Finland! Don't you all think that it is a quite a large number of channels in a country with only 5 000 000 people?

As you can see, there are lots of American tv shows in Finland. They usually have titles translated to Finnish, e.g. "Prison Break" = "Pako", "Quantum Leap" = "Aikahyppy", "The Simpsons" = "Simpsonit".
